The RFID seal or E-Seal device that transmit containers information as it passes a reader device and stop working if the containers has been tampered whit of damage.
The e-seal combines physical protection with an RFID sensor to monitor for tampering and ensure the integrity of containers shipped globally. Compliant with ISO 17712:2013 and Indian customs standards, it is also known as an E-seal (electronic seal) or RFID seal. E-seals are available in active, passive, and semi-active types, with passive E-seals operating without a battery.
| SPECIFICATION |
|---|
| Cable Length: Pin-80mm : Body - 72mm |
| Function: E-seal can't read any RFID DATA before use. E-seal can read RFID DATA when closed. E-seal can't read any RFID DATA after cutting. |
| Feature: E seal is used to secure cargo on Intermodal transport Including containers, trailers, rail cars, air cargo and other containers. E seals reduce risk of pilferage and theft. E-Seals avail of Direct Port Entry and enjoy reduced cargo examination at Indian Ports & also reduces time taken now for manual inspection procedures. E-seals can speed shipments through the supply chain and increase visibility. Ensures safety of cargo to consignees |
| Chip: Alien H4 |
| Protocol: EPC Global C1G2 ISO 18000-6C |
| EPC: 128 Bit |
| TID: 64 Bit |
| Reading Range: > 10M |
| Operating Temp: -30ºC ~ +80ºC |
